1. All-back-contact (ABC) cell technology
Most solar panels run their electrical busbars across the front face of each cell. Those thin silver lines block a small but meaningful fraction of incoming light. AIKO's ABC design moves all the electrical contacts to the rear of the cell — so the front face is pure silicon receiving pure sunlight, with no busbars in the way.
The result is a panel that genuinely looks different (no visible lines, a uniform deep-black surface) and that performs measurably better, especially in lower light conditions. For South Wales roofs facing less-than-perfect orientation or with occasional shading, ABC technology is a real technical advantage, not a marketing claim.
2. Class-leading efficiency
AIKO's current-generation residential modules reach module efficiencies of around 23–24% — among the highest available for domestic-scale installations. In practical terms that means more kilowatt-hours per square metre of roof, which matters when you've got a limited area to work with or want to hit a specific annual generation target without covering the whole roof.
Typical AIKO residential modules we specify sit in the 445 W – 475 W range at standard test conditions, in familiar 60-cell residential sizes that fit cleanly on UK roofs.
3. Better shade performance
Because ABC cells are architected differently, they degrade less gracefully under partial shade than standard PERC or TOPCon modules. A passing chimney shadow, nearby branches, or a neighbouring roof can take a smaller bite out of production than you'd see on a comparable conventional panel. Combined with panel-level optimisers or microinverters where appropriate, this is a useful tool for awkward South Wales roofs.

Flagship AIKO modules we install
AIKO's residential ABC range is tightly curated. Two modules cover almost every UK domestic install we quote.
Neostar 2S (Mono-Glass)
445–470 W · all-back-contact · 54-cell all-black
The flagship ABC module. ~23% module efficiency, excellent partial-shade behaviour, and a fully uniform black face — no visible busbars or grid lines from the ground. The module we reach for on tight roofs and aesthetically sensitive installs.
Neostar 2S+ (Dual-Glass)
495–520 W · dual-glass bifacial · 60-cell
A step up in power and longevity. Glass-glass construction resists delamination and moisture ingress better than polymer backsheets, which matters over a 30-year life. Our pick for larger arrays where per-panel yield is critical.
